SAN DIEGO, CA — A Powerball ticket worth more than half a million dollars was sold to a lucky lottery player in San Diego.
A Powerball ticket with five numbers, but missing the Powerball number, was purchased at a gas station in San Diego, the California Lottery announced. The ticket worth $559,925 was sold at Chevron at 3359 University Ave.
The numbers drawn Saturday were 16, 32, 55, 59, 66 and the Powerball number was 3. The estimated jackpot was $212 million.
Drawings take place every Monday, Wednesday and Saturday. The estimated jackpot is $225 million for Monday's drawing.
The odds of matching all five numbers and the Powerball number is 1 in 292.2 million, according to the Multi-State Lottery Association, which conducts the game. Powerball is played in 45 states, the District of Columbia, Puerto Rico and U.S. Virgin Islands.
